the wider you go the shorter you can go, if you're getting a 6'1 and you're semi new to surfing I'd say have the board at least 19 1/4 inches wide

and the board does take on a lot of water when there is a ding
my advice is to sand off the spot u sun-cured and suck out any water that could have gotten in then re-seal it up
